Why banks are boosting credit card interest rates and fees
In recent years, banks have sharply raised interest rates and penalty fees on credit cards. As the economy tanks and banks' mortgage-related losses balloon, some banks are stepping up such increases to boost revenue. Bearing the brunt are consumers for whom a jump in rates and fees can make it tougher to pay their bills at a time when household budgets already are being stretched.
(AFX UK Focus) 2008-11-17 08:40 Vietnam Money-Interest rates ease, dong stabilises
HANOI, Nov 17 Reuters - Vietnamese banks cut their dong lending rates further on Monday after a central bank rate cut earlier this month, while the dollar/dong exchange rate stabilised, bankers said. Vietnam's four largest banks lowered their overnight dong loans to between 8 and 10 percent on the interbank market, against a fixing of 9.16 percent a week ago, Reuters data showed. Vietcombank, ...
